…………..is the nematode that causes the
blackhead disease in banana crops?Solution
Radopholus similis is a species of nematode known commonly as the burrowing nematode. Eventually, burrowing nematodes can migrate from roots into the rhizome causing black, circular lesions, hence the name blackhead disease. It is also called the toppling disease of Banana.
